Guest vertico Posted December 4, 2010 Report Posted December 4, 2010 (edited) my vega is bricked .. does any one has any instruction to revive it? edit: I have found a way to get into the USB mode so that I can flash the official 1.04 exe: 1) hold "back" button 2) Press "power" button for 2 sec 3) let go power button then 2 sec let go "back" there should be a blue light beneath the webcam. if you tilt the tablet, then you ll find it. This allow usb connection to Windows PC. (no wonder my mac has no response what so ever) then I quickly flash the 1.04 exe. after reboot on tablet. and it s good as new. advent really need to properly support Mac ... ;) Edit2: oops .. should have read advent website properly... they have a full flash procedure in a pdf: http://www.myadventvega.co.uk/full_system_...nstructions.pdf Edited December 4, 2010 by vertico
